为什么现在自学编程难成功
-
自学编程之所以难以成功,主要有以下几个原因:
-
缺乏系统性教学:自学编程往往缺乏系统性的教学,难以获得全面的知识体系和方法论。编程领域庞大而复杂,没有一个明确的学习路径和教学大纲,自学者往往难以找到正确的学习资源和顺序。
-
缺乏指导和反馈:自学编程往往缺乏指导和反馈机制,学习者很难知道自己是否在正确的轨道上,难以发现和纠正自己的错误。没有人能够指导和纠正学习者的学习方法和思维方式,导致学习效果大打折扣。
-
缺乏动力和毅力:自学编程需要长时间的坚持和不断的练习,对于缺乏动力和毅力的人来说,很难坚持下去。编程是一门需要不断实践和反复尝试的技能,没有足够的毅力和坚持,很难达到熟练的水平。
-
缺乏合适的学习资源:自学编程需要有合适的学习资源,包括书籍、在线教程、视频教程等。然而,市面上的学习资源质量参差不齐,很难找到适合自己的学习材料。同时,一些免费的学习资源往往过于简单或过于复杂,难以满足学习者的需求。
综上所述,自学编程之所以难以成功,主要是因为缺乏系统性教学、指导和反馈机制、动力和毅力以及合适的学习资源。对于想要自学编程的人来说,需要克服这些困难,制定合理的学习计划,选择适合自己的学习资源,并保持坚持和不断实践的态度。
1年前 -
-
自学编程难以成功的原因有以下几点:
-
缺乏系统性的学习路径和指导:自学编程需要掌握一系列的知识和技能,包括编程语言、算法、数据结构等等。而缺乏系统性的学习路径和指导,很容易陷入学习的迷茫和困惑中,不知道从何开始,也不知道如何进一步提升自己。
-
缺乏专业的反馈和指导:自学编程很容易陷入一个孤立的学习状态,没有人可以给予及时的反馈和指导。而编程是一个实践性很强的学科,只有通过不断的实践和反馈才能够真正掌握。缺乏专业的反馈和指导,很容易陷入一种误区,无法及时发现和纠正自己的错误。
-
缺乏动力和坚持的能力:自学编程需要很强的动力和坚持的能力。编程是一个相对较为复杂和抽象的学科,需要持续的学习和实践才能够真正掌握。而很多人在自学的过程中往往会遇到困难和挫折,如果缺乏动力和坚持的能力,很容易放弃或者半途而废。
-
缺乏实践和项目经验:自学编程往往缺乏实践和项目经验。编程是一个实践性很强的学科,只有通过不断的实践和项目经验才能够真正掌握。而自学的过程中,很难有机会接触到真实的项目和实际的编程工作,无法真正锻炼和提升自己的实践能力。
-
缺乏交流和合作的机会:自学编程往往缺乏交流和合作的机会。编程是一个团队合作的学科,需要与他人进行交流和合作才能够更好地完成项目和解决问题。而自学的过程中,很难有机会与他人进行交流和合作,无法获得他人的意见和建议,也无法学习到他人的经验和技巧。
总之,自学编程难以成功是因为缺乏系统性的学习路径和指导、缺乏专业的反馈和指导、缺乏动力和坚持的能力、缺乏实践和项目经验以及缺乏交流和合作的机会。要成功自学编程,需要克服这些困难,找到适合自己的学习方法和资源,并保持持续的学习和实践。
1年前 -
-
自学编程难以成功的原因有很多,下面我将从几个方面来解析。
- 缺乏系统的学习计划和方法
自学编程需要有一个系统的学习计划和方法,但是很多自学者没有清晰的学习目标和计划,盲目学习零散的知识点,没有形成系统性的学习框架。此外,缺乏科学的学习方法,不能高效地获取知识和解决问题,导致学习效果不佳。
解决方法:建立一个明确的学习目标,制定合理的学习计划。可以参考一些优质的编程教材或在线教育平台,按照教程的顺序学习,逐步建立知识体系。同时,学会使用搜索引擎和技术社区,及时解决遇到的问题。
- 缺乏实践经验
编程是一门实践性很强的学科,理论知识只有通过实践才能真正掌握。很多自学者过于注重理论知识,而忽视了实践的重要性。缺乏实践经验,很难将所学知识运用到实际项目中,也难以在实际工作中有所突破。
解决方法:在学习编程的同时,要注重实践。可以通过做一些小项目或者参与开源项目来提升实践能力。此外,可以参加一些编程比赛或者找一些实习机会,锻炼自己的实践能力和解决问题的能力。
- 缺乏交流和合作机会
自学编程往往意味着一个人独自面对电脑,缺乏与他人交流和合作的机会。编程是一个团队合作的过程,通过交流和合作可以互相学习和提升。而自学者往往难以找到合适的交流和合作机会,导致学习进展缓慢。
解决方法:积极参与技术社区和论坛,与其他编程爱好者交流和分享经验。可以加入一些技术交流群或者参加一些线下的技术活动,与其他开发者进行面对面的交流。此外,可以考虑加入一些编程团队或者找一些合作伙伴,共同完成一些项目。
- 缺乏坚持和毅力
自学编程是一个长期的过程,需要持续的学习和不断的实践。很多自学者在刚开始学习的时候兴趣高涨,但是随着时间的推移,遇到困难和挫折时容易放弃。缺乏坚持和毅力,很难成功地自学编程。
解决方法:要树立正确的学习态度,保持持续学习的动力。可以和其他自学者一起组建学习小组,相互鼓励和监督。此外,可以定期回顾自己的学习成果,及时调整学习方法和计划,保持学习的动力和兴趣。
总结起来,自学编程难以成功主要是因为缺乏系统的学习计划和方法、缺乏实践经验、缺乏交流和合作机会以及缺乏坚持和毅力。要解决这些问题,需要制定合理的学习计划,注重实践,积极交流和合作,坚持学习并保持持续的动力。
1年前